You are considering two identical firms, one levered and the other unlevered. Both firms have expected EBIT of $33,000. The value of the unlevered firm (VU) is $110,000. The corporate tax rate is 30%. The cost of debt is 12%, and the ratio of debt to equity is 1 for the levered firm.

Use MM propositions in a world without bankruptcy to answer the following questions.

(a) Calculate the cost of equity for both the levered and unlevered firms.

(b) Calculate the WACC for both firms.

(c) Why is the cost of equity higher for the levered firm, but the WACC lower?

(d) What is the value of the levered firm?
